Understanding the Core Benefits: Why Phosphating Matters
Phosphating is a chemical conversion coating process that modifies metal surfaces, typically steel, to improve their properties. The primary benefits include:
- Enhanced Corrosion Resistance: Phosphating creates a conversion layer that acts as a barrier against rust and other forms of corrosion, significantly extending the lifespan of metal components.
- Improved Paint Adhesion: The porous nature of the phosphate layer provides an excellent 'key' for subsequent paint or coating applications, ensuring better adhesion and preventing delamination.
- Wear Resistance and Lubricity: Certain types of phosphating, particularly zinc and manganese phosphates, can improve wear resistance and provide a stable base for lubricants, crucial for moving parts.
- Electrical Insulation: Phosphate coatings offer good electrical insulation properties, making them suitable for specific applications in the electronics industry.

- Type of Phosphating: The most common types are iron, zinc, and manganese phosphate. Iron phosphate is often used for light-duty corrosion protection and as a paint base. Zinc phosphate offers better corrosion resistance and wear resistance, making it ideal for demanding applications. Manganese phosphate is excellent for wear resistance and lubrication.
